What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Copenhagen to Birmingham?

The average price of all flights from Copenhagen to Birmingham cl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to Birmingham on a Saturday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Monday is the most expensive day to fly from Copenhagen to Birmingham.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Tuesday and avoiding Sundays for the best deals.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Copenhagen to Birmingham?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Copenhagen to Birmingham,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Copenhagen to Birmingham is November, where tickets cost £171 on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and June, where the average cost of tickets is £230 and £212 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Copenhagen to Birmingham?

To calculate daily average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each day before departure over the last year for flights from Copenhagen to Birmingham,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each month.
To get a below average price on the flight from Copenhagen to Birmingham,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 89 days before departure.

Which airlines fly direct between Copenhagen and Birmingham?

Airline and price data is aggregated from results in KAYAK’s search results from the last 2 weeks for flights from Copenhagen to Birmingham.
There is just one airline that flies from Copenhagen to Birmingham direct and that is Scandinavian Airlines. The best one-way deal found from Scandinavian Airlines for the route is £154.

How many flights are there between Copenhagen and Birmingham per day?

There is a maximum of 1 direct flight a day that takes off from Copenhagen and lands in Birmingham, with an average flight time of 1h 59m. The most common departure time is 08:00 and most flights take off in the morning. Each week, there are 6 flights.

How long does a flight from Copenhagen to Birmingham take?

Direct flights cover the 622 miles separating Copenhagen and Birmingham in about 1h 55m.

What’s the earliest departure time from Copenhagen to Birmingham?

Early birds can take the earliest flight from Copenhagen at 08:20 and will be landing in Birmingham at 09:20.

What’s the latest departure time from Copenhagen to Birmingham?

If you prefer to fly at night, the latest flight from Copenhagen to Birmingham jets off at 19:40 and lands at 20:35.

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from Copenhagen to Birmingham?

    Copenhagen airport is called Kastrup Copenhagen and the only airport in Birmingham is Birmingham.

  • Which aircraft models fly most regularly from Copenhagen to Birmingham?

    The Canadair (Bombardier) Regional Jet 900 is the aircraft model that flies most regularly on the Copenhagen to Birmingham flight route.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Copenhagen to Birmingham?

    Star Alliance is the only airline alliance operating flights between Copenhagen and Birmingham.

  • On which days can I fly direct from Copenhagen to Birmingham?

    You can catch a direct flight from Copenhagen to Birmingham on on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day, Friday, and Sunday.
